Kaspersky targets virtualised environments with new security product
Running independent security software on each virtual machine is not an efficient way to protect your systems, so Kaspersky Lab has launched Kaspersky Security for Virtualization. There's more to virtualisation than simply moving a system image from a physical PC onto a virtual machine. Rogue Applications Remover finds malware your security software misses
ESET has released Rogue Applications Remover, a stand-alone console tool that tries to remove rogue antivirus and similar unwanted malware which regular security tools might miss. The program is very basic, with minimal options.
